Understanding Hard Water: Its Effects on Plumbing
Tough water, an usual concern in many homes, can have considerable effect on plumbing systems. Recognizing these effects is vital for maintaining the durability and effectiveness of your pipelines and components.

Introduction


Hard water is water that contains high degrees of liquified minerals, mostly calcium and magnesium. These minerals are harmless to human health yet can ruin plumbing framework gradually. Allow's explore how tough water impacts pipes and what you can do about it.

What is Hard Water?


Tough water is characterized by its mineral web content, specifically calcium and magnesium ions. These minerals get in the water system as it percolates through limestone and chalk deposits underground. When hard water is heated up or delegated stand, it often tends to form range, a crusty buildup that abides by surfaces and can trigger a range of concerns in plumbing systems.

Effect on Pipeline


Hard water influences pipelines in a number of detrimental means, primarily through scale build-up, decreased water flow, and raised deterioration.

Range Buildup


One of one of the most usual issues triggered by difficult water is scale buildup inside pipes and components. As water streams through the pipes system, minerals precipitate out and comply with the pipe walls. With time, this build-up can narrow pipeline openings, causing decreased water flow and enhanced stress on the system.

Lowered Water Circulation


Natural resources from hard water can progressively reduce the size of pipelines, restricting water flow to taps, showers, and home appliances. This lowered circulation not only influences water stress however also increases energy usage as appliances like hot water heater should work more difficult to deliver the same quantity of warm water.

Deterioration


While tough water minerals themselves do not create rust, they can intensify existing corrosion concerns in pipelines. Scale accumulation can trap water versus metal surfaces, increasing the rust process and potentially resulting in leakages or pipeline failure gradually.

Appliance Damages


Beyond pipes, hard water can also harm home appliances linked to the water supply. Devices such as hot water heater, dishwashing machines, and cleaning machines are especially susceptible to range buildup. This can decrease their performance, increase upkeep prices, and shorten their life-span.

Checking and Treatment


Evaluating for hard water and implementing suitable therapy measures is key to mitigating its results on pipes and home appliances.

Water Softeners


Water conditioners are the most usual remedy for treating hard water. They function by trading calcium and magnesium ions with salt or potassium ions, effectively decreasing the hardness of the water.

Various Other Treatment Options


Along with water softeners, various other treatment alternatives include magnetic water conditioners, reverse osmosis systems, and chemical ingredients. Each method has its benefits and viability depending upon the seriousness of the hard water problem and household needs.

The Impact of Hard water on Your Plumbing and Appliances


One of the most common issues associated with hard water is scale buildup. Scale is a hard, crusty deposit that forms on the inside of pipes and plumbing fixtures due to the minerals in hard water. Over time, these deposits can accumulate and cause a range of problems for your plumbing system.



How scale buildup affects plumbing and water pressure



As scale continues to accumulate inside your pipes, it narrows the passage through which water can flow. This makes it increasingly difficult for water to pass through, leading to a number of problems that can affect your home’s plumbing system.



Slow drains are a common issue associated with scale buildup. As the pipe diameter narrows, water has a harder time draining, which can result in slow-moving drains and even standing water in sinks and bathtubs.



Reduced water pressure in showers and faucets is another consequence of scale accumulation. As the buildup restricts water flow, less water is able to pass through your pipes at any given time. This leads to weak water pressure in your showers and faucets, making everyday tasks like washing your hands or taking a shower less enjoyable and effective.



Clogged pipes are perhaps the most severe problem that can arise from scale buildup. In extreme cases, the accumulated scale can completely obstruct the passage of water through the pipe, resulting in a total blockage. This can cause backups in your plumbing system, potentially leading to costly repairs and even water damage to your home.

The Impact of Hard Water on Appliances



Reduced efficiency and lifespan




Hard water can have a significant impact on the efficiency and lifespan of your appliances. The scale buildup caused by hard water can clog or damage various components, leading to decreased performance and increased energy consumption. Appliances that use water, such as dishwashers, washing machines, and water heaters, are particularly susceptible to hard water damage.



The lifespan of your appliances can also be shortened by hard water. Scale buildup can cause increased wear and tear on components, leading to more frequent breakdowns and a shorter overall lifespan. By addressing hard water issues, you can help to extend the life of your appliances and save money on repairs and replacements.



Dishwashers and hard water



Dishwashers are especially vulnerable to the effects of hard water. Scale buildup can cause poor water circulation, leading to dishes that are not properly cleaned. Additionally, the minerals in hard water can leave unsightly spots and streaks on glassware and other dishes. Regular maintenance and the use of water softeners can help to mitigate these issues and keep your dishwasher running smoothly. Learn how to clean and maintain your dishwasher.



Washing machines and hard water



Hard water can also impact the performance of your washing machine. Scale buildup can clog the water inlet valve, leading to reduced water flow and decreased cleaning efficiency. Hard water can also cause detergent to be less effective, resulting in dingy, stiff, and scratchy clothing. By addressing hard water issues, you can ensure that your washing machine continues to provide optimal performance and extend its lifespan.



Water heaters and hard water



Water heaters are particularly susceptible to the negative effects of hard water, as they are in constant contact with water and have internal components that can be damaged by scale buildup. The accumulation of scale inside the water heater can lead to reduced efficiency, higher energy bills, and decreased hot water availability. Moreover, scale buildup can cause increased wear on the heating element, shortening its lifespan and potentially leading to costly repairs or replacements.



One of the key components within a water heater that is particularly vulnerable to hard water damage is the anode rod. The anode rod is a sacrificial component designed to corrode in place of the water heater’s tank, thereby extending its life. However, hard water can cause the anode rod to corrode more quickly than intended, leading to a decreased lifespan for both the rod and the water heater as a whole. Regular inspection and replacement of the anode rod can help ensure that it continues to protect your water heater from corrosion.



To protect your water heater from the damaging effects of hard water, it is important to implement regular maintenance procedures and consider using water softeners. Regular maintenance, such as flushing the water heater to remove sediment and scale buildup, can help maintain its efficiency and prolong its lifespan. This process involves draining the water from the tank and flushing it with fresh water to remove any accumulated sediment and scale
